Finite volume methods for solving hyperbolic problems on euclidean manifolds without radially symmetric initial condition
Many interesting physical systems are successfully modeled with time-dependant conservation laws on smooth manifolds, M. Examples of such systems include hydrodynamic flows in non-trivial geometry, important in aerodynamic modeling. Though in many applications the manifold is simply Euclidean space...
